gpt4 book ai didi

ibm-mq - WebSphere MQ 在 WMQ 资源管理器中查看 channel

转载 作者:行者123 更新时间:2023-12-02 02:21:10 24 4
gpt4 key购买 nike

我们需要执行 SET AUTHREC PROFILE($cname) OBJTYPE(CHANNEL) GROUP('mq-user') AUTHADD(...) 以便 channel 显示 WMQ Explorer,正确吗?当前访问被阻止。

最佳答案

是的。通过本问题和上一个问题中定义的 AUTHREC 配置文件,您已授权用户连接到 QMgr、将请求放入命令队列并在模型队列上接收回复。命令服务器需要知道该组有权对其他对象执行哪些操作。例如,在您授权之前,它不会显示或让群组成员控制 channel 。

查看哪些对象需要授权的快速方法是 WMQ Explorer 中的基于角色的权限向导。右键单击 QMgr,选择对象权限,然后添加基于角色的权限,如下所示:

WMQ Explorer menus to pull up Role Based Authorities wizard

接下来,选择“组”并输入组名称:

Authorization commands to allow display of all objects for the <code>mq-user</code> group

向导输出 setmqaut 命令,您可以从命令行以 mqm 形式发出这些命令。对于这些,有等效的 AUTHREC 命令。我建议运行 setmqaut 版本,然后使用 dmpmqcfg 捕获规则,而不是手动转换它们。命令。

使用上述设置在向导中创建的实际命令是:

setmqaut -m QM75_1 -t qmgr -g mq-user +connect +inq +dsp
setmqaut -m QM75_1 -n "**" -t q -g mq-user +dsp
setmqaut -m QM75_1 -n "**" -t topic -g mq-user +dsp
setmqaut -m QM75_1 -n "**" -t channel -g mq-user +dsp
setmqaut -m QM75_1 -n "**" -t process -g mq-user +dsp
setmqaut -m QM75_1 -n "**" -t namelist -g mq-user +dsp
setmqaut -m QM75_1 -n "**" -t authinfo -g mq-user +dsp
setmqaut -m QM75_1 -n "**" -t clntconn -g mq-user +dsp
setmqaut -m QM75_1 -n "**" -t listener -g mq-user +dsp
setmqaut -m QM75_1 -n "**" -t service -g mq-user +dsp
setmqaut -m QM75_1 -n "**" -t comminfo -g mq-user +dsp

setmqaut -m QM75_1 -n SYSTEM.MQEXPLORER.REPLY.MODEL -t q -g mq-user +dsp +inq +get
setmqaut -m QM75_1 -n SYSTEM.ADMIN.COMMAND.QUEUE -t q -g mq-user +dsp +inq +put

关于ibm-mq - WebSphere MQ 在 WMQ 资源管理器中查看 channel ,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/11799377/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com